  1. George Kein Hayward Coussmaker was born in London in 1759. His father, Evert Coussmaker, died in 1763, and his mother, Mary, was remarried, to Sir Thomas Hales, Baronet, of Howlett, Kent.   3. Henry Fane was the younger of two sons of Thomas Fane, who succeeded as eighth Earl of Westmorland in 1762 upon the death of his distant cousin. The Fanes had been long established at Fulbeck Hall, near Grantham, Lincolnshire, and Henry Fane was born at Fulbeck on May 4, 1739

  4. The sitter was the only daughter and heiress of Richard Milles, and married Lewis Thomas Watson of Lees Court, Kent, in 1785. Watson was descended collaterally from the Earls of Rockingham, and his mother had been a granddaughter of the second Duke of Rutland and a daughter of Henry Pelham, a former prime minister

  7. Reynolds visited Italy for three years while in his twenties and seized the opportunity to study works from antiquity to the more recent Baroque era. As he explored churches and collections, Reynolds filled many sketchbooks with notes and drawings.
